Understanding Bone Health
Before we delve into the potential risks of a high protein diet, it’s important to understand the basics of bone health. Our bones are constantly undergoing a process called remodeling, where old bone tissue is broken down and new tissue is formed. This process is regulated by our bodies to ensure that our bones stay strong and healthy.
Calcium, which is commonly found in dairy products, is essential for strong bones. However, protein also plays a crucial role. In fact, protein makes up about 50% of our bone volume and around one-third of its mass. It provides the structure and strength that our bones need to support our bodies.
The High Protein Debate
So, why do some experts claim that a high protein diet can harm our bones? Well, one theory suggests that consuming too much protein may increase the acidity in our bodies. To neutralize this acidity, our bodies draw calcium from our bones, which could potentially weaken them over time.
However, it’s important to note that the research on this topic is still inconclusive. While some studies have shown a correlation between high protein intake and bone mineral density loss, others have found no such association. Furthermore, many factors can influence our bone health, including our age, sex, genetics, and overall dietary patterns.

What About Dogs?
While we’ve been discussing the potential effects of a high protein diet on human health, it’s worth mentioning that the same concerns do not necessarily apply to our furry friends. Dogs, for instance, have different nutritional needs and can tolerate a higher protein intake without adverse effects on their bone health.
